Carthage voted second-most beautiful town in Missouri

The Route 66 town of Carthage, Mo., was named the state’s second-most beautiful town by readers of Rural Missouri magazine, reported the Carthage Press.

The wine-country burg of Hermann won the top spot, and Carthage beat out Ste. Genevieve for the runner-up position.

“Carthage boasts one of Missouri’s most beautiful town squares and courthouses,” the publication said. “It’s also a well-known spot on Route 66.”
